Boerne Church Plans $20M Expansion Project

Currey Creek Church to build new 1,400-seat worship center and office spaces.

Published on Feb. 22, 2026

Currey Creek Church, a fast-growing congregation in Boerne, Texas, has announced plans for a $20 million expansion project that will include a new 28,000-square-foot worship center able to seat 1,400 people, as well as additional office and meeting spaces.

Why it matters

The expansion reflects the rapid growth of Currey Creek Church, which has seen its congregation swell in recent years as people have moved to the Texas Hill Country region outside of San Antonio. The project is part of a broader trend of megachurches investing in large-scale facilities to accommodate growing numbers of worshippers.

The details

Currey Creek Church's design plans call for the new 1,400-seat worship center, as well as additional office spaces and meeting rooms to support the church's operations and ministries. Construction on the project is expected to begin later this year and take approximately 18 months to complete.
